Painting Description
Pescatore Bretone Che Porta Un Paniere, translated as "Breton Fisherman Carrying a Basket," is a notable work by the French artist Léon Augustin Lhermitte. Lhermitte, born in 1844 and active until his death in 1925, was renowned for his realistic depictions of rural life and labor. His works often captured the essence of the French countryside, focusing on the daily lives of peasants and workers with a keen eye for detail and a profound sense of empathy.
This particular painting exemplifies Lhermitte's mastery in portraying the dignity and resilience of the working class. The subject, a Breton fisherman, is depicted carrying a basket, presumably filled with his catch. The choice of a Breton fisherman is significant, as Brittany, a region in northwest France, has a rich maritime heritage and a strong cultural identity. Lhermitte's attention to regional detail underscores his commitment to authenticity and his respect for the subjects he portrayed.
Lhermitte's technique in Pescatore Bretone Che Porta Un Paniere is characterized by his use of natural light and meticulous brushwork, which bring a lifelike quality to the scene. The textures of the fisherman's clothing, the basket, and the surrounding environment are rendered with precision, highlighting Lhermitte's skill in capturing the material reality of his subjects. The composition of the painting draws the viewer's eye to the central figure, creating a sense of immediacy and presence.
Throughout his career, Lhermitte was celebrated for his ability to convey the nobility of everyday labor. His works were well-received in both France and abroad, earning him numerous accolades and a lasting place in the canon of realist art. Pescatore Bretone Che Porta Un Paniere stands as a testament to Lhermitte's enduring legacy and his profound connection to the people and landscapes of rural France.
